Leeds 0-0 Arsenal - Sunday 22nd November, 2020


football forum

Recommended Posts

  • Administrator

Kick-off 16.30 (GMT)

Live on Sky Sports

1200px-Leeds_United_F.C._logo.svg.png      VS      1200px-Arsenal_FC.svg.png

Head to Head Record
Leeds - 41
Draws - 32
Arsenal - 47

Last Meeting
06/01/2020 - Arsenal 1-0 Leeds (FA Cup)

Last Fixture
19/01/2011 - Leeds 1-3 Arsenal (FA Cup)
